ABSTRACT Background: Hepatitis B virus (HBV) infection in patients who lack detectable hepatitis B surface antigen (HBsAg) is called occult hepatitis B infection. Such infections have been frequently identified in patients with chronic hepatitis Cliver disease, but their prevalence is not known. Background and purpose: Hepatitis B virus (HBV) is considered to be one of the most important etiological factors of liver complication around the world. Interactions of host immune responses with HBV have a crucial role in the outcome of the infection.
